Can I file after the deadline? Yes, late filing is possible. However, significant penalties and interest charges apply to delayed submissions.
Must I file below the taxable limit? Generally no. Nevertheless, certain categories including property owners must file regardless of income levels.
How long should I keep records? Keep documents for at least five years. Therefore, you’re ready for possible NBR audits.
Can I submit a corrected return? Yes, corrected returns are accepted before assessment completion. However, NBR approval is required.
What happens if I find mistakes? Mistakes can be fixed through revised submissions. Meanwhile, quick correction reduces problems.
